174.453. Board, appointment — certain residency requirements — terms, voting members — term, nonvoting student member — board appointments, Missouri Southern State University, Missouri Western State University, and Southeast Missouri State University. — 1. Except as provided in section 174.450 and in subsection 6 of this section, the board of governors shall be appointed as follows:
(1) Five voting members shall be selected from the counties comprising the institution's historic statutory service region as described in section 174.010, except that no more than two members shall be appointed from any one county with a population of less than two hundred thousand inhabitants;
(2) Two voting members shall be selected from any of the counties in the state which are outside of the institution's historic service region; and
(3) One nonvoting member who is a student shall be selected in the same manner as prescribed in section 174.055.
2. The term of service of the governors shall be as follows:
(1) The voting members shall be appointed for terms of six years; and
(2) The nonvoting student member shall serve a two-year term.
3. Members of any board of governors selected pursuant to this section and in office on May 13, 1999, shall serve the remainder of their unexpired terms.
4. Notwithstanding the provisions of subsection 1 of this section, the board of governors of Missouri Southern State University shall be appointed as follows:
(1) Six voting members shall be selected from any of the following counties: Barton, Jasper, Newton, McDonald, Dade, Lawrence, and Barry provided that no more than three of these six members shall be appointed from any one county;
(2) Two voting members shall be selected from any of the counties in the state which are outside of the counties articulated in subdivision (1) of this subsection;
(3) One nonvoting member who is a student shall be selected in the same manner as prescribed in section 174.055; and
(4) The provisions of subdivisions (1) and (2) of this subsection shall only apply to board members first appointed after August 28, 2004.
5. Notwithstanding the provisions of subsection 1 of this section, the board of governors of Missouri Western State University shall be composed of eight members appointed as follows:
(1) Five voting members shall be selected from any of the following counties: Buchanan, Platte, Clinton, Andrew, and DeKalb ;
(2) One nonvoting member who is a student shall be selected in the same manner as prescribed in section 174.055; and
(3) The provisions of subdivisions (1) and (2) of this subsection shall only apply to board members first appointed after August 28, 2005.
6. (1) Notwithstanding the provisions of subsection 1 of this section to the contrary, the board of governors of Southeast Missouri State University shall be appointed as follows:
(a) Two voting members shall be selected from any of the following counties: Butler, Dunklin, Mississippi, New Madrid, Pemiscot, Scott, or Stoddard;
(b) Two voting members shall be selected from any of the following counties: Bollinger, Cape Girardeau, Madison, Perry, Ste. Genevieve, or St. Francois;
(c) Two voting members shall be selected from any of the following counties or areas: Franklin, Jefferson, Lincoln, St. Charles, St. Louis, St. Louis City, or Warren;
(d) One voting member shall be selected from one of the counties in the state; and
(e) One nonvoting member who is a student shall be selected in the same manner as provided in section 174.055.
(2) The provisions of paragraphs (a) to (c) of subdivision (1) of this subsection shall only apply to board members first appointed after August 28, 2021.
--------
(L. 1995 S.B. 340 § 1 subsecs. 2, 3, A.L. 1999 S.B. 218, A.L. 2004 S.B. 1080, A.L. 2005 S.B. 98, A.L. 2006 S.B. 650, A.L. 2021 H.B. 297)
